Output e630b3f06f61f7a00aab40ab4d285fb0a49c49fe2dbb32fc1c7d4bc48f3a64eb:0

value
94927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0068a4b19ef0850be1f77841f4e5a6576cabd186 OP_EQUAL
address
31jBHHnL8u78q4yJ1TVrD81eBGFn1cZt9G
transaction
e630b3f06f61f7a00aab40ab4d285fb0a49c49fe2dbb32fc1c7d4bc48f3a64eb
spent
true